Carrollton Elementary School welcomed most of the kindergarten students in the county, registering 122 students.
Within Carroll County schools, the highest student count was found in ninth grade, with the smallest class sizes seen in pre-kindergarten.
Statewide, Carroll County ranked 83rd in enrollment numbers, with a total of 2,810 students enrolled in the 2023-24 school year. It was ranked 82nd the year before.
In 2022, Ohio saw an average student-to-teacher ratio of approximately 1:15, which is an improvement for the state and is lower than the national average of 1:16.
Despite the apparent improvement, this positive trend is overshadowed by a general decline in public school enrollments, which was accelerated by the pandemic. This decline, aligned with the steady number of teachers in the state over the last 10 years, has led to low student-to-teacher ratios.
School name | # of Kindergarten Students Enrolled | % of Student Body | Total Enrollment |
---|---|---|---|
Carrollton Elementary School | 122 | 15.2 | 803 |
Malvern Elementary School | 46 | 17.2 | 268 |
Conotton Valley Elementary School | 40 | 13.9 | 287 |
Carrollton High School-Carrollton Middle School | 0 | 0 | 948 |
Malvern Middle School | 0 | 0 | 134 |
Malvern High School | 0 | 0 | 163 |
Conotton Valley High School | 0 | 0 | 198 |
